"Every visit to Pappas Bros. is a reminder of what a classic steakhouse should be. Friendly greetings and firm handshakes, leather seating and dim lighting, and a maniacal obsession with meat—it’s all butchered and dry-aged in house. The resulting steaks are simple and beefy in the best way, seasoned with just salt and pepper and finished with butter. The bar is well-stocked with whiskeys, and its famously lengthy wine list has nearly 4,000 distinct labels, so there’s always something new to drink. Save yourself some reading, and ask the sommelier to recommend a bottle that goes beyond the usual suspects." - kevin gray

"I was struck that Pappas Bros. Steakhouse’s head sommelier, Steven McDonald, earned the Michelin Guide’s Sommelier Award in 2024 for his repertoire and vast knowledge overseeing the restaurant’s three massive wine lists at one of Texas’s most lauded steakhouses; McDonald’s path to wine is notable too — he originally wanted to be in music and worked as a school band director before moving to New York City, entering hospitality with his brothers, starting as a server, and then focusing on wine." - Eater Staff
